Blackstrap

Blackstrap is a dark, viscous variety of molasses, a byproduct of the refining of sugarcane. Less sweet but containing more nutrients than other grades of molasses, it’s what remains after the third and final boiling in the sugar extraction process. Blackstrap molasses is used to make livestock feed. “Blackstrap” is military slang for coffee. Blackstrap is the name of a provincial park in Saskatchewan, Canada. “Black Strap Molasses” was the title of a 1951 novelty song recorded by movie stars Groucho Marx, Jimmy Durante, Jane Wyman, and Danny Kaye.
